    Export and Import Default App Associations for New Users in Windows  


    Have a look at this:

    Some firefox problems - Page 22 - Windows 10 Forums

    If you run the linked softwares SetUserFTA and GetUserFTA you can use to export/ import file associations.

    Just use the config files edited to make any changes needed.

    Example. Set Paint as default for png :& jpg images:

    Config file:

    Code:
    Code:
     .jfif, PBrush .jpe, PBrush .jpeg, PBrush .jpg, PBrush .png, PBrush

    How to Reset, Export and Import Default App Associations on Windows [​IMG]

    Place config file in SetUserFTA directory and name it SetUserFTA.config

    Run command SetUserFTA.exe SetUserFTA.config to associate.
    Example. Set Windows Photo Viewer as default for png :& jpg images:

    Config file:

    Code:
    Code:
     .jfif, PhotoViewer.FileAssoc.Tiff .jpe, PhotoViewer.FileAssoc.Tiff .jpeg, PhotoViewer.FileAssoc.Tiff .jpg, PhotoViewer.FileAssoc.Tiff .jxr, PhotoViewer.FileAssoc.Tiff

    How to Reset, Export and Import Default App Associations on Windows [​IMG]

    If you are going to mess about with it - suggest exporting current file associations to a backup config file so that you can restore them.

    Sorry, I'm not quite sure I understand how this works. Suppose that my Windows 10 computer only has one user account (a local one created when first installing Windows).

    Given the above, is it possible to use the method here to change default applications based for myself (the current - and only - user)? You mention that it "this only gets applied to "new" user accounts," so I would assume no. If that's the case, do you know of ANY automated way to set default file associations for the current and only user on Windows 10?

    It seems to me like it's stored in the registry; for example, when I used RegistryChagesView to see what changed after setting the default application for images from Windows Photo Viewer to Paint, I got this:


    How to Reset, Export and Import Default App Associations on Windows [​IMG]


    However, when I try to use a .reg file to import over those entries, I receive the following error:


    How to Reset, Export and Import Default App Associations on Windows [​IMG]


    I still get the error even after restarting the computer and trying again. Further, I suspect (but haven't yet tested) that the hash value isn't always identical (I guess it's calculated whenever you set the default application?), and I'm not sure what it represents or if it's important.

    Basically, I just need some automated way to set the default applications for the current user, but I keep running into problems. Is there any way to do this?

    Edit:
    Now that I think about it, there HAS to be an automated way to do this. When you install some programs, they will automatically associate certain extensions with themselves (such as when you install Python; .py files are automatically set to run with Python.exe). So there's got to be a way that I can do it too, right?
